DAHI RAITA


Cucumber & Tomato Raita

This is a yoghurt based accompaniment extremely popular with Rice dishes in India.

Preparation Time 10 mins
Serves 2

INGREDIENTS

Yoghurt 1 cup
Cucumber Chopped ½ Cup
Tomato Chopped ½ Cup
Roasted Cumin Seeds Powder ½ tsp
Salt To taste

METHOD

In a Bowl Mix All the ingredients together.

Serve as an accompaniment to Rice or along with Dry Vegetable & Roti.

TIP- You can prepare this in advance & Refrigerate for a while. Tastes Best When Served Cold. You can add Onions as well. 

VEGETARIAN PULAO (PILAU)


This is a simple veg rice dish usually served with raita or occasionally as an accompaniment to a mild curry.

Cooking Time 15 mins
Serves 4

INGREDIENTS
Rice 1 cup
Onion 1 Medium (Sliced)
Mixed Vegetables (½ cup include Peas, Carrot, Cauliflower, Cottage Cheese or Potato)
Ginger 2 inch Piece
Garlic Clove 2
Bay Leaf 1
Clove 2
Green Cardamom 2
Black Cardamom 1
Cinnamon Stick 1 small
Salt
Red Chilly powder
Garam Masala
Cumin Seeds 1 tsp
Desi Ghee (Clarified Butter)

METHOD 


Wash Rice Several times to get rid of the starch and then soak it for about 10 minutes.

Heat Ghee in a pan. Add Cumin Seeds, Bay Leaf, Green Cardamom, Black Cardamom, Clove and Cinnamon, sauté for a minute. Then add the ginger, garlic and onions sauté for 2 mins or till the onion changes its color and becomes transparent.

Add the vegetables and the remaining ingredients. Add the water and let it boil for a minute.


Cook On Low Flame for 10 Minutes or till the rice absorbs all the water.

Serve Hot With A Curry Or Raita.

KADAHI PANEER


This is a quick recipe of Indian cottage cheese, full of flavours and is a healthy alternative to the traditional paneer recipes.

 

Preparation Time 20 mins

Serves 2 to 3


INGREDIENTS

Paneer (cottage cheese) 200gms
Onion 1 medium
Green Chilly 1slit
Dry Red Chilly 1
Tomatoes 2 medium sized
Tomato Puree 2 tbsp
Ginger 2 inch Piece
Garlic Clove 2
Salt to taste
Red Chilly Powder 1/2 teaspoon
Coriander Powder 1/2 teaspoon
Coriander Seeds 1/2 teaspoon
Karahi Paneer Masala 1 tsp
Garam Masala 1/4 teaspoon.
Cream or Milk 3 tablespoons
Kastoori Methi (Optional)
Chopped fresh coriander for garnish.


METHOD

Cut The Onion in 4 parts and take out each layer. In a pan Heat Oil, Add Coriander Seeds, Cumin Seeds, 1 Dry Red Chilly & Saute. Now Add Chopped Ginger, Garlic, Green Chill, Onion & Sauté for a minute.

Add Bell Pepper & Chopped Tomato Cook for 2 mins. Now Add the Cottage Cheese, Salt, Red Chilly Powder, Corriander Powder, Karahi Paneer Masala & Tomato Puree & Mix Well.

After 5 minutes add 2 tablespoons of Cream or Milk and simmer and cook for another 5 minutes. Your curry is ready now.

Add Kastoori Methi & Garam Masala. Mix Well. Serve hot with Roti, Naan or Lachha Paratha.

TIP - If using frozen Paneer, after defrosting, put paneer in boiling water for about 10 mins.This will make it soft.
